Hey, neat! I remember reading about Extrude Hone way back when it was new and exotic. Basically it's a polishing/honing process that forces this really thick (and disgusting looking) abrasive putty through the intake/manifold/whathaveyou and enlarges the interior and/or polishes it out, depending on how far you go. It's a really neat thing because it can polish out areas that you can't normally reach with a grinder.

I've been toying with this process for awhile
Since I have a extra set of intake plenum and manifold I'm stuck with what can I do to mod these items. Extrude Honing have been mentioned on this board many times, and I think a couple have tried it with little to no gains depending on mods. One or two SC guys have tried it with no gains, but keep in mind these guys are already running over atmospheric pressure with their blowers. Maybe a N/A motor will be different, but Nissans casting process for our manilfods are alot better than most domestic manufacturers. I've taken a close look at my spare plenum/manifold and it looks pretty good in stock form, no abnormal internal casting flaws. Some have stated just enlarging the ports will yield the same gains for alot less, who knows? I have a have a bored out TB in my garage waiting for me to decide what I'm going to do with these two items, I would like to install all three items the same time. But for $500+ it's kinda hard to decide.
